After testing dozens of cheap nail art supplies on AliExpress, the truth is simple: a few gems, plenty of meh. The usable ones usually have decent brush control, consistent gel texture, and packaging that survives shipping. Sounds basic, but honestly—that’s where most listings fail.
Some budget nail art kits honestly caught me off guard. I expected flimsy tools, but a few sets came with usable gels and surprisingly decent extras. Not salon-level at all, but for home experiments? One random kit even became my regular starter pick.
Beginners tend to overbuy—been there. Affordable nail design gear like dotting tools and striping brushes can be a gamble. When they work, it’s fun and creative; when they don’t, they bend or fray fast. Still, for practice, they’re worth it.
Testing nail art starter sets means sorting through brushes, decals, gels, and tiny extras you didn’t expect. Some kits feel thoughtfully packed, others feel random. The real test is after a couple weeks—does the brush still behave or give up immediately?
DIY manicure accessories and low-cost nail decor products can be a smart way to save money, but only if you pick carefully. I keep a small list of reorders and a longer mental list of “never again.” That’s the whole cycle—trial, error, and patience.
